Transaction eef643d52397a104e0ac955e43e60d8c75e6af0c824a42f88a686a19681d41a5
1 Input
1 Output
-
eef643d52397a104e0ac955e43e60d8c75e6af0c824a42f88a686a19681d41a5:0
- value
- 863294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94a1ce518a3bf7c84f4b82abc709694ea7c7f8db OP_EQUAL
- address
- 3FEumQcNnMF9B5c6QzF9uVnytr5m2UR8TQ